How to describe the characters in novels!

1 answer
2024-09-20 02:05

Character description was a very important part of novel writing. It could show the characteristics of the characters through their appearance, personality, behavior, psychology and many other aspects. Here are some techniques for describing characters: 1. Appearance Description: By describing the character's clothes, hairstyle, makeup, behavior, etc., the character's image is presented. When describing the appearance, one should pay attention to the characteristics of the character, such as the figure, facial features, temperament, etc. 2. Character Description: By describing the character's preferences, habits, speech, behavior, etc., the character's character is revealed. When describing a character, you should pay attention to the characteristics of the character, such as the character's kindness, intelligence, courage, cunning, etc. 3. Description of behavior: By describing the actions, manners, reactions, etc. of the character, it shows the behavior of the character. When describing behavior, one should pay attention to the actions, expressions, and psychology of the character, such as the character's running, jumping, thinking, and reaction. 4. Psychological Description: By describing the thoughts, feelings, emotions, etc. of the character, the psychological state of the character is revealed. When describing a character's psychology, one should pay attention to grasping the character's inner feelings, contradictions, fears, desires, and so on. 5. Description of details: Through describing the details of the character such as catchphrases, habits, eyes, gestures, etc., to show the character's personality and characteristics. Pay attention to the accuracy and liveliness of the details. To describe a character, one needed to be meticulous and grasp the characteristics of the character to highlight the character's personality and image. At the same time, we must pay attention to the accuracy and liveliness of the language so that the readers can truly feel the image and characteristics of the characters.

How to describe the characters in the novel

1 answer
2024-09-08 05:09

Character description was a very important element in a novel. Through the language, behavior, appearance, and heart of the characters, it could portray their personality, emotions, and characteristics so that readers could better understand and feel the plot and characters in the novel. Here are some techniques for describing characters: 1. Language Description: Use the language, accent, and words of the characters to show their personality and characteristics. For example, a smart and witty character might use some humorous and witty language to solve problems, while a sad and lonely character might use some low and bitter language to express his emotions. 2. Description of behavior: Through the behavior, movements, posture, etc. of the characters to show their personality and characteristics. For example, a brave and decisive character might take action without hesitation to solve a problem, while a lazy and passive character might show lazy and passive behavior. 3. Appearance Description: Through the appearance, clothing, hairstyle, etc. of the character, it shows their personality and characteristics. For example, a tall and strong character might wear a gorgeous dress to show his status and wealth, while a petite and cute character might wear simple and cute clothes to show his gentleness and cuteness. 4. Description of the inner heart: Through the inner feelings, thoughts, emotions, etc. of the characters, their personalities and characteristics are revealed. For example, a smart and rational character might show a calm and rational side, while a sensitive and kind character might show a gentle and emotional side. When describing a character, you should pay attention to the character's personality, emotions, and characteristics so that the reader can better understand and feel the plot and characters in the novel. At the same time, he had to pay attention to the use of appropriate language and action descriptions so that the readers could feel the emotions and actions of the characters more vividly.
